Prospector orders new rig pair

Building up: Prospector at Chinese yard SWS

Prospector Offshore Drilling has exercised options for a pair of additional high-specification jack-up newbuilds at Chinese yard Shanghai Waigaoqiao Shipbuilding (SWS) at a cost of around $220 million apiece.

The latest orders for the Friede & Goldman JU-2000E-design harsh-environment rigs bring to six the total number of newbuilds the Oslo-listed rig contractor has under construction at both SWS and compatriot builder Dalian Shipbuilding, with four and two units on order at the yards respectively.

The rigs, designed and outfitted for work in the North Sea off the UK, Netherlands and Denmark, are scheduled for delivery in the third quarter of 2015 and first quarter of 2016.
